Blog

Agile Produktentwicklung: Best Practices für ISVs und Startups

Divya Prathima

Divya Prathima

Aktualisiert Oktober 15, 2025
5 Minuten

Agile wurde als die am besten geeignete Softwareentwicklungsmethodik für die Erstellung der heutigen digitalen Lösungen angepriesen. Ihr unbestreitbarer Erfolg hat sie auf andere Abteilungen wie Vertrieb, Marketing, Personalwesen und die gesamte Software-Business-Methodik übertragen. Später entwickelte sich die Methode zu einer Denkweise mit Werten, die man bei der Arbeit und im Leben im Allgemeinen verinnerlichen und befolgen kann. Es ist keine Überraschung, dass die agilen Mantras auch für ISVs und Startups gut sind. Hier erfahren Sie, wie und warum es so gut für sie ist.

ISVs und Startups sollten sich zweifelsohne auf ihre Fähigkeiten zur Produktentwicklung konzentrieren. Das ist es, wovon ihre Ideen und Ziele abhängen. Allerdings reicht ihre Kompetenz bei der Produktentwicklung nicht aus, um ihnen Erfolg zu garantieren. Sie brauchen etwas mehr.

Die Softwareentwicklung erfordert ein Verständnis der Prozesse, der Menschen, der Möglichkeiten, die der Markt bietet, und der Beschränkungen. Die Methodik, die schrittweise zu diesem Verständnis führt, ohne zu überwältigend zu sein, ist Agile. Agile hilft Unternehmen dabei, die Anforderungen und Reaktionen des Marktes abzuschätzen und ermöglicht es uns, das Wasser zu testen, bevor wir uns tiefer und breiter vorwagen, um Ressourcen zu sparen. Es vereinfacht die Softwareentwicklung, den Betrieb und die endgültigen Ergebnisse oder Softwareprodukte.

Agile kann Ihnen helfen, Ihre Vision mit den Bedürfnissen des Marktes und der Kunden in Einklang zu bringen.

Die Vision von ISVs und Start-ups sollte mit den Bedürfnissen des Marktes übereinstimmen. Sie kann aber auch völlig neu und bahnbrechend sein und von anderen im Ökosystem nicht erwartet werden. So oder so sollte man den Benutzern Zeit geben, neue Ideen zu akzeptieren und auszuprobieren, das System auf Fehler zu testen und Feinabstimmungen vorzunehmen, um kontinuierlich die bestmöglichen Softwarelösungen zu schaffen. Eine gründliche Marktanalyse ist unerlässlich, um die Produkt-Roadmap zu definieren.

Trotz all dieser Maßnahmen können sich die Märkte und Technologien schneller entwickeln als unser Produktangebot. Das Festhalten an einem eingefrorenen Produktplan oder einer Strategie und deren minutiöse Befolgung ist keine Erfolgsgarantie. Außerdem könnten unsere Produkte dadurch für die Märkte und Kunden ungeeignet sein. Es ist sinnvoll, unsere Vision, Strategien und Anforderungen zu überprüfen. Unsere Methoden sollten dies zulassen.

Agiles Vorgehen macht Softwareprodukte und -plattformen offen für Änderungen. Die Zeit wird nicht mit falschen Spekulationen und Dokumentationen vergeudet, sondern konstruktiv genutzt, um Produkte schrittweise zu entwickeln und sie so mit der Vision in Einklang zu bringen.

Übersetzen Sie Ihre Vision in Anforderungen und setzen Sie diese mit Hilfe agiler Methoden um.

Die Vision eines Unternehmens definiert sein Produkt- und Dienstleistungsangebot. Sie wird dann in Anforderungen übersetzt. Die Anforderungen werden am besten in Sprints erfüllt und in kleinen, aber häufigen Upgrades geliefert. Es ist möglich, Anforderungen bei Bedarf auch in späteren Entwicklungsphasen zu ändern.

Durch die Arbeit in Sprints sind Unternehmen also besser gerüstet, ihre Strategien und Lösungen zu verbessern, um gute Geschäftsergebnisse zu erzielen.

Egal, ob es sich um zusammenhängende, verteilte, entfernte oder hybride Teams handelt - eine klare Kommunikation ist ein Muss.

Die agile Methodik fördert die Zusammenarbeit zwischen Mitarbeitern aus Wirtschaft und Technik. Die Teams sind weitgehend selbstorganisiert und bestehen aus motivierten Einzelpersonen. Solche selbstorganisierenden Teams passen Architekturen und Designs an ihre spezifischen Anforderungen an.

Geplante Kommunikation während regelmäßiger Stand-up-Meetings sorgt für eine klare und rechtzeitige Kommunikation zwischen den Teammitgliedern, so dass jeder die Entwicklungen, Anpassungen, Änderungen und damit den Zweck hinter seiner Arbeit versteht.

Rückblick - Der demütigende und zugleich inspirierende Schritt

Nach jedem Sprint treffen sich agile Teams, um ihre Prozesse und Ergebnisse zu überprüfen und Revue passieren zu lassen. Sie analysieren, was gut gelaufen ist, was nicht, und warum. Solche Rückblicke helfen Unternehmen, die Qualität ihrer Ergebnisse zu verbessern.

Abgesehen von den Geschäftsergebnissen halten diese Prozesse Unternehmen, Teams und Einzelpersonen auf dem Boden. Indem sie ihnen klar aufzeigen, wie sie sich verbessern können, motivieren sie auch und machen die Ziele erreichbarer und damit die Reise angenehmer.

Schlichtheit ist die ultimative Raffinesse.

Agile Metriken drehen sich um Teams und ihre Ergebnisse. Bei den Ergebnissen kann es sich um die Wertschöpfung oder die Vereinfachung von Prozessen handeln. Diese Ergebnisse sind am wichtigsten, nicht so banale Daten wie verbrauchte Stunden oder sogar hinzugefügte Funktionen. Bei Agile geht es darum, das zu liefern, was die Kunden brauchen oder mögen. Eine solche Klarheit trotz wechselnder Anforderungen vereinfacht sowohl die Softwareentwicklungsprozesse als auch das Design der Endprodukte.

Auch wenn sich viele Vorteile auf Agile als Methode beziehen, ist Agile viel mehr als das. Agile zu machen ist nicht genug. "Agil sein" ist viel besser, sowohl für Unternehmen als auch für Einzelpersonen, bei der Arbeit und im Leben.

Obwohl ursprünglich angenommen wurde, dass Agile nur in Teams funktioniert, die sich von Angesicht zu Angesicht treffen können, hat es sich als erfolgreich erwiesen, Unternehmen dabei zu helfen, sich entsprechend den sich ändernden Bedingungen weiterzuentwickeln. Viele Unternehmen wie coMakeIT haben die Prinzipien von Agile auch in verteilten Teams erfolgreich umgesetzt. Unternehmen, die schneller auf die Bedürfnisse des Marktes reagiert haben, insbesondere während der Covid-19-Lockdowns, bürgen für den Erfolg von Agile in jeder Art von Team mit klaren Kommunikationskanälen.

Möchten Sie Ihre Softwareentwicklung transformieren und belastbare Produkte erstellen? Glauben Sie auch, dass Agile eine Art Ideologie ist und nicht nur eine Methode? Lassen Sie uns weiter reden.

Verfasst von

Divya Prathima

The author was a java Developer at coMakeIT before turning into a stay-at-home-mom. She slowed down to make art, tell stories, read books on fiction, philosophy, science, art-history, write about science, parenting, and observe technology trends. She loves to write and aspires to write simple and understandable articles someday like Yuval Noah Harari. We are very happy to have her back at coMakeIT and contribute to our relevant and thought provoking content.

Contact

Let’s discuss how we can support your journey.